Police return with sniffer dogs and excavator to Valsayn House

Things have taken an interesting new turn in the Valsayn “House of Horrors” case as in a bizarre twist, there is now some doubt about whether it was Hannah Mathura’s body that was found last week.

The skeleton, according to police sources, may have belonged to a male.

This means that Hannah may still be unaccounted for.

From 8:45 am on today, police returned to the family home at Butu Road, Valsayn and officers began asking relatives on the compound questions.

Shortly after, members of the canine unit arrived with a cadaver dog.

Ten minutes later, an excavator from the regional corporation arrived and went to the back of the compound to begin digging.
